DEE: an architecture for distributed virtual environment gaming

Simon Powers, Mike Hinds and Jason Morphett

Show affiliations


This paper presents a distributed virtual environment architecture targeted specifically at network games. It outlines the requirements for supporting a game genre known as graphical multi-user dungeons or dimensions, and shows how these requirements can be met by a novel approach to the distribution of the game environment model. An implementation of the architecture is covered, together with the initial conclusions drawn from the implementation process.
